I was noodling around with some graphics code the other day to try to produce some schematic representations of water waves for a book that I'm working on. I wanted to produce a little animation of what happens when you throw a stone into a pond. It didn't have to be very flashy, I just wanted it to be qualitatively correct, that is, I wanted to produce a drawing of a wave that spread out from a central source and decreased in amplitude with time and distance from the source. So I started out with the venerable sin(x)/x function:
There, right in the center of an actual physical water wave, was my spike! It didn't have a pointy end: surface tension had made the point shrink up into a sphere, but the spike was unmistakable. It was as if the math was trying to take me by the throat and tell me, "No, water really does work this way."
In retrospect it is actually obvious why water has to work this way. You drop a stone into a pond and the stone makes a hole in the water. The stone keeps falling through the water (because the stone is denser), and as soon as it has moved out of the way, water rushes back in from all sides to fill the hole. All that water rushing in meets at the center of the hole, and because of inertia and the fact that water is not compresible, it has to keep moving, so it has to go somewhere. The only place left for it to go is up.
In 1960 Eugene Wigner published a famous paper entitled "The Unreasonable Effectiveness of Mathematics in the Natural Sciences" which first pointed out this phenomenon, that math often "takes you by the throat" and forces you towards the correct answer even if it sometimes takes people a while to realize that this is what is going on. I thought it was cool to experience this phenomenon firsthand.
 The reason the spike is there, mathematically speaking, is that the function sin(x-t)/(x+t) must be zero when x=t and t>0, but the limit of the function as x->t from above is -1. So at t=0 it has to look like -sin(x)/x, but at t=epsilon it has to have two zero-crossings at x = +/- epsilon. The only way to satisfy that condition, along with continuity constraints, is to have a spike. It is might even be possible to prove that no mathematical function can possibly produce all the desired qualitative characteristics of water waves (damping, forward motion in time, conservation of mass) without a spike, but that's above my pay grade.